Pembroke Welsh Corgi
This Pembroke Welsh Corgi is a tiny, lively breed that's perfect for families and individuals seeking a lively companionship. Pembroke corgis are loving, trustworthy, and are great protectors. They're also one of the smartest breeds of dogs and can be easily trained.

Appearance
Pembroke Welsh Corgis are fairly small dogs, measuring 10-12 inches at the shoulders and weighing 20-30 pounds. These dogs have legs that are shorter and a large body, which provides them with a slim center of gravitation. This makes them ideal for herding activities, as they can quickly dodge and change direction. Pembroke corgis come in a variety of colours that include red, sableand fawn and black, and brindle. They have pointy ears, and their tail is usually clipped to approximately half of its original length.
Temperament
It is the Pembroke Welsh Corgi is an capable, intelligent, and affectionate dog breed. They are the perfect companion for those who are active and can provide them with lots of exercise and love. Pembroke Welsh Corgis are friendly and outgoing with those that they are familiar with, but they can be reserved with strangers. They are generally good with other dogs and animals However, they could attempt to herd them. The early introduction of puppy socialization and training classes are recommended to aid Your Pembroke Welsh Corgi learn to behave appropriately around the other dogs and humans. Pembroke Welsh Corgis are active dogs that require lots of exercise. A daily exercise or walk is essential, as is with a safe and secure backyard where they can run around and romp.
